python sqlalchemy连接mysql 文心快码BaiduComate 要使用Python的SQLAlchemy库连接MySQL数据库,你可以按照以下步骤进行操作: 1. 安装必要的库 首先,你需要安装SQLAlchemy和PyMySQL库。PyMySQL是一个纯Python实现的MySQL客户端库,用于在Python程序中连接和操作MySQL数据库。你可以使用以下命令通过pip安装这些库: bash pip ...
37 def insert_one(self,sql,args): 38 conn,cursor = self.create_conn_cursor() 39 res = cursor.execute(sql,args) 40 conn.commit() 41 print(res) 42 conn.close() 43 return res 44 45 def update(self,sql,args): 46 conn,cursor = self.create_conn_cursor() 47 res = cursor.execute(s...
在config.py配置文件的片段中,可以看到连接池的具体参数设置: fromsqlalchemyimportcreate_engine DATABASE_URL='mysql+pymysql://username:password@localhost/db_name'engine=create_engine(DATABASE_URL,pool_size=10,max_overflow=5,pool_timeout=30) 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 调试步骤 为...
sqlalchemy.exc.InvalidRequestError: Could not evaluate current criteria in Python. Specify 'fetch' or False for the synchronize_session parameter. 但这样是没问题的: 复制代码代码如下: session.query(User).filter(or_(User.id == 1, User.id == 2, User.id == 3)).delete() 搜了下找到《Sql...
1.安装SQLAlchemy,MySQLdb模块 MySQLdb安装教程:http://www.cnblogs.com/jfl-xx/p/7299221.html SQLAlchemy模块: pip install sqlalchemy 2.初始化连接 1#!/usr/bin/env python2#-*- coding: utf-8 -*-34fromsqlalchemyimportColumn, create_engine5fromsqlalchemy.typesimport*6fromsqlalchemy.ormimportsession...
除了使用 pymysql 库连接 MySQL 数据库之外,我们还可以使用 SQLAlchemy 的 create_engine 函数创建 MySQL 数据库连接引擎,并使用 Pandas 库中的read_sql函数直接将查询结果转化为 Pandas dataframe 对象。 # 步骤 1:创建 MySQL 数据库连接引擎 from sqlalchemy import create_engine ...
通过SQLAlchemy,我们可以使用Python代码操作数据库,而不需要编写原生的SQL语句。这大大提高了开发效率,并使得代码更易于维护。 首先,我们需要安装SQLAlchemy库。可以使用pip命令来安装: ``` pip install SQLAlchemy ``` 安装完成后,我们可以开始连接和操作MySQL数据库。 连接MySQL数据库 在使用SQLAlchemy连接MySQL数据...
使用SQLALCHEMY_POOL_RECYCLE配置试试 有用 回复 查看全部 2 个回答 推荐问题 字节的 trae AI IDE 不支持类似 vscode 的 ssh remote 远程开发怎么办? 尝试一下字节的 trae AI IDE ([链接])安装后导入 vscode 的配置,好像一起把 vscode 的插件也导入了也能看到 vscode 之前配置的 ssh remote 但是连不上看...
SQLAlchemy是基于python的ORM(模型关系映射)框架,框架是建立在DB-API基础上的,使用关系对象映射进行数据库操作;即将类和对象转换成sql,使用数据api执行sql并获取执行结果。 SQLAlchemy本身是无法操作数据库的,必须依赖python的数据库接口规范DB-API;Dialect用于和数据api进行交互,根据配置的不同调用不同数据库API,从而实...
sqlalchemy, 在编程领域使用广泛,借助pymysql等第三方库。因此既支持原生sql也支持orm。git✨只1.7k, 开发活跃 组件 Engine连接。 任何sqlalchemy程序的开始点。是数据库和它的api的抽象。把sql声明从sqlalchemy传递到database 使用create_engine()函数创建一个engine, 它被用于直接连接数据库,或被传递给一个Session...